i have a 95 accord lx 2dr. i recently bought a CODE alarm and i want to put it in my car but my electric door locks are not working properly. i can manually lock them, the passenger lock i just push it to lock it but the drivers side i have to pull the handle and then lock it. also when i push my lock button my doors do not lock and i hear a noise coming from the passengers door. what could be the problem,should i just get new locks,and what about my alarm do i need to figure out my locking situation before i go hooking up the alarm?thank you

My first gut (and I do have a gut) response is to condem the Driver's door Lock Actuator. It incorporates the micro-switches which signal the lock module to control the whole system. Sounds like someone in the past attacked the lock mechanism with a slim-jim; trying to open the door without a key - and caught something they shouldn't have.

Without the locks functioning (particularly the driver's door) the alarm will not disarm with the key. You would forever be DOOMED (DOOMED I SAY!) to using the remote fob to arm/disarm the alarm.

Well first if you have a aftermarket alarm it won't arm or disarm with the key. You can unplug the factory lock motor and add a acurator in place of it. The micro switch is in the key cylinder. So your okay with that. You can go ahead and add your alarm and be good to go with out the door locks not working. You just will not have keyless entry.

Not entirely true. My Diverse Electronics Viper Alarm is wired to work in conjunction with the OEM keyless remote system on my SE. It can be armed/disarmed by either the remote or the key. It's wired to the lock control module bypassing the OEM keyless reciever. The same would apply to any Accord with power locks, regardless of the presence of the KRS.
